🥖 Pain Protéiné Vitalité – Seeded Power Loaf with Greek Yoghurt & Psyllium
👨🍳 How to Make It (Step-by-step)
✔️ Preheat The Oven
Set your oven to 180°C and line a baking tray with parchment.
💡Preheating ensures even baking and a crisp crust.
✔️ Mix Wet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together Greek yoghurt and eggs until smooth.
💡Use full-fat yoghurt for better texture and richness.
✔️ Add Dry Base
Stir in almond flour (optional), psyllium husk, salt and baking powder.
💡Sift baking powder to avoid clumps and ensure even rise.
✔️ Incorporate Seeds
Add flax seeds and mixed seeds, stirring until a firm dough forms.
💡Toast seeds beforehand for deeper flavour.
✔️ Shape The Dough
Form the dough into a round or oval loaf and place on the tray.
💡Wet your hands slightly to prevent sticking.
✔️ Top With Extra Seeds
Sprinkle additional seeds over the top and press gently.
💡This adds crunch and visual appeal.
✔️ Bake The Loaf
Bake for 60 minutes until golden and firm.
💡Tap the bottom — it should sound hollow when done.
✔️ Cool Completely
Let the loaf cool on a wire rack before slicing.
💡Cooling helps set the crumb and prevents crumbling.
✔️ Slice & Serve
Cut into even slices and enjoy fresh or toasted.
💡Use a serrated knife for clean cuts.
✔️ Store For Later
Wrap tightly and refrigerate or freeze for future use.
💡Slice before freezing for easy portioning.
🛒 Ingredients
🥛 Greek yoghurt – 150 g, thick and full-fat
🥚 Eggs – 3 medium
🌰 Almond flour – 100 g (optional)
🌾 Flax seeds – 50 g
🌿 Mixed seeds – 150 g (pumpkin, sesame, chia)
🧂 Salt – 1 tsp
🥄 Baking powder – 2 tsp
🍃 Psyllium husk – 12 g

🎯 Common Mistakes to Avoid
🎯 Using runny yoghurt — it can make the dough too wet
🎯 Skipping psyllium — loaf won’t hold together properly
🎯 Overbaking — results in a dry, crumbly texture
🎯 Not cooling before slicing — causes tearing and uneven cuts
🎯 Using too many wet ingredients — affects structure
🎯 Forgetting to press seeds — they’ll fall off during baking
🎯 Not measuring accurately — balance of moisture is key
🎯 Using old baking powder — loaf won’t rise properly
🎯 Overmixing — can lead to dense, gummy texture
🎯 Storing uncovered — loaf will dry out quickly

❓ FAQ
❓ Can I make this dairy-free?
Yes — use coconut or soy yoghurt instead 🥥
❓ Can I skip almond flour?
Yes — it’s optional and can be replaced with seed flour 🌰
❓ Is it suitable for keto diets?
Absolutely — low in carbs and high in fat and fibre 💪
❓ Can I freeze it?
Yes — slice before freezing for easy portioning ❄️
❓ How long does it keep?
Up to 5 days in the fridge, tightly wrapped 🧊
❓ Can I add sweet ingredients?
Yes — dried fruit, cinnamon or vanilla work well 🍯
❓ Is psyllium necessary?
Yes — it binds the loaf and adds fibre 🍃
❓ Can I bake in a loaf tin?
Definitely — just line it well and adjust baking time 🧁
